dw怎么在js文件写入中文

dw怎么在js文件写入中文

DW如何在JS文件中写入中文

要在JavaScript文件中正确写入中文,确保编码设置正确、使用Unicode转义序列、避免使用特殊字符。 其中,确保编码设置正确 是最重要的一点,因为它直接影响浏览器和编辑器对中文字符的解读。本文将详细解释如何在JavaScript文件中正确写入和使用中文,确保程序的稳定性和可读性。

一、确保编码设置正确

在JavaScript文件中写入中文字符时,最常见的问题是编码问题。默认情况下,许多文本编辑器和集成开发环境(IDE)可能不会使用适合中文的编码格式。为了避免乱码和兼容性问题,建议将文件保存为UTF-8编码。

1. 检查和设置文件编码

大多数现代文本编辑器和IDE都支持UTF-8编码。例如,在Visual Studio Code中,可以通过以下步骤设置文件编码:

  1. 打开文件。
  2. 在右下角点击当前编码(通常是UTF-8Plain Text)。
  3. 选择“Save with Encoding”,然后选择“UTF-8”。

在Dreamweaver中,可以通过以下步骤设置文件编码:

  1. 打开文件。
  2. 选择“修改” -> “页面属性”。
  3. 在“标题/编码”选项卡中,选择“Unicode (UTF-8)”。

2. 使用HTML meta标签

如果你正在编写的是一个包含JavaScript的HTML文件,可以在HTML文件的<head>部分添加以下meta标签来指定编码:

<meta charset="UTF-8">

这将确保浏览器以UTF-8编码读取文件,从而正确显示中文字符。

二、使用Unicode转义序列

在某些情况下,你可能需要在JavaScript代码中使用Unicode转义序列来表示中文字符,特别是当你处理的是纯JavaScript文件而不是HTML文件时。Unicode转义序列的格式是 u 后跟四位十六进制数字。

例如,中文字符“中”的Unicode码是4E2D,可以在JavaScript中这样写:

var chineseChar = "u4E2D";

console.log(chineseChar); // 输出:中

这可以确保在任何编码环境中,字符都能被正确解析和显示。

三、避免使用特殊字符

某些特殊字符在不同的编码格式下可能会导致问题。为了确保你的JavaScript代码能够在各种环境中稳定运行,尽量避免使用特殊字符,并保持代码的简洁和可读性。

四、使用合适的开发工具

选择合适的开发工具和环境可以极大地减少编码问题。现代IDE如Visual Studio Code、Sublime Text、WebStorm等都提供了对UTF-8编码的良好支持。此外,使用研发项目管理系统PingCode和通用项目协作软件Worktile可以帮助你更好地管理项目,提高团队协作效率。

1. 研发项目管理系统PingCode

PingCode是一款强大的研发项目管理系统,专为软件开发团队设计,提供了丰富的功能,如需求管理、任务追踪、缺陷管理等。通过PingCode,你可以轻松管理项目中的每一个细节,确保项目按时交付。

2. 通用项目协作软件Worktile

Worktile是一款通用项目协作软件,适用于各种类型的团队协作。它提供了任务管理、时间管理、文件共享等功能,帮助团队更高效地协作和沟通。通过Worktile,你可以轻松跟踪项目进展,提高团队的工作效率。

总结

在JavaScript文件中写入中文字符时,确保编码设置正确、使用Unicode转义序列、避免使用特殊字符 是最重要的三点。选择合适的开发工具和项目管理系统,如PingCode和Worktile,可以进一步提高项目管理和团队协作的效率。通过以上方法,你可以确保JavaScript文件中的中文字符被正确解析和显示,避免编码问题带来的困扰。

相关问答FAQs:

1. 在JS文件中如何写入中文字符?
在JS文件中写入中文字符非常简单。只需要直接在代码中使用中文字符即可。例如,你可以通过以下方式来定义一个包含中文字符的变量:

var chineseString = "你好,世界!";

或者直接在代码中使用中文字符:

console.log("这是一条包含中文字符的输出语句。");

2. 为什么在JS文件写入中文字符时会出现乱码?
如果在JS文件中写入中文字符时出现乱码,很可能是因为文件的编码格式不正确。确保你的JS文件采用UTF-8编码格式保存,以便正确显示中文字符。你可以通过文本编辑器的保存选项来选择合适的编码格式。

3. 如何在JS文件中使用Unicode编码表示中文字符?
除了直接使用中文字符外,你还可以使用Unicode编码来表示中文字符。每个中文字符都有一个对应的Unicode码。例如,中文字符"你"的Unicode码是u4f60,字符"好"的Unicode码是u597d。你可以通过以下方式在JS文件中使用Unicode编码:

var chineseString = "u4f60u597d";

这样就可以在代码中正确表示中文字符了。

文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/3854861

(0)
Edit1Edit1
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部